I thank the Minister of State. The point is that the divergence between these figures is such that the HSE figure is simply incredible. I have a huge concern that twice in this Chamber over the past month, the Minister for Health rejected the INMO figures. He insisted there were just eight people on trolleys on 1 February when he was here and he told me that I did not have my homework done. It turns out that he has just written a note to say that he cannot attend school today. The fact he is not here is an absolute disgrace and he has bottled it. I feel sorry for the Minister of State because the fact is that everyone in Limerick knows the INMO figures are correct. Everyone knows there are more than 100 patients on hospital trolleys. Members of all parties have acknowledged it over the last couple of weeks in this Chamber. Yet, the Minister for Health is in absolute denial in relation to this issue. It is hugely disrespectful to the INMO. It is hugely disrespectful to SIPTU, to the front-line workers there in the hospital and at the very least, the Minister needs to come into this Chamber and correct the record and acknowledge that he is fundamentally wrong when it comes to the numbers of people on trolleys in UHL.
